Evolution of Drug Resistance in Bacteria,mics of microbial populations affects the evolution of antibiotic resistance. We focus on the role of spatial and temporal drug gradients and show that in certain situations bacteria can evolve de novo resistance within hours. We identify factors that lead to such rapid onset of resistance and discuss their relevance for bacterial infections.

How Biophysics May Help Us Understand the Flagellar Motor of Bacteria Which Cause Infections,comotive force for bacteria. This locomotion provides a key aspect of bacteria’s prevalence. Here, we outline the biophysics behind the assembly, the energetics, the switching and the rotation of this remarkable nanoscale electric motor that is Nature’s first wheel.

Neutron Reflectivity as a Tool for Physics-Based Studies of Model Bacterial Membranes, for the inner and outer membranes of Gram-negative bacteria. Studies of the interactions of antimicrobial peptides with monolayer and bilayer models for the inner and outer membranes have revealed information about the molecular control of the outer membrane permeability, and the mode of interactio
